Transaction 70186aa752b86f72645300a2668977d204401cf98488108470d1826ea62069c3
1 Input
1 Output
-
70186aa752b86f72645300a2668977d204401cf98488108470d1826ea62069c3:0
- value
- 391080
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a9154279bff12873ccaa2112f1b370e1895f2f5
- address
- bc1ql2g4gfumlufgw0x25ggj7xehpcvftuh4kfps9p